Output ebc4a17f786f2611aeb54f7fec71dbec6a232124279aa8bec7bbf77967bd5111:5

value
51716000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b8582adc95d7529740bbb3cfe59739b0ce2b7b OP_EQUAL
address
MUZwnFtppPDkXe49SmyWQkLsXYFW1EvY7J
transaction
ebc4a17f786f2611aeb54f7fec71dbec6a232124279aa8bec7bbf77967bd5111
spent
true